c#计算机取倒数代码
时间: 2024-09-14 13:17:01 浏览: 83
C#双线性、临近点、反距离三种插值源代码
在C#中,你可以通过简单的数学运算来计算一个数的倒数。倒数的定义是一个数的乘法逆元,即一个数与其倒数相乘的结果为1。对于非零数值,其倒数可以通过将1除以该数值来计算。下面是一个简单的C#代码示例,展示了如何计算一个数值的倒数:
```csharp
using System;
class Program
{
static void Main()
{
double originalNumber = 10; // 原始数值
double reciprocal = 1 / originalNumber; // 计算倒数
Console.WriteLine("倒数是:" + reciprocal);
}
}
```
如果你需要对特定类型的数值进行倒数计算,比如整数或者浮点数,并且考虑到数值可能为零的情况,代码可能需要进行适当的修改以处理这些异常情况:
```csharp
using System;
class Program
{
static void Main()
{
double originalNumber = 10; // 原始数值
if (originalNumber != 0)
{
double reciprocal = 1 / originalNumber; // 计算倒数
Console.WriteLine("倒数是:" + reciprocal);
}
else
{
Console.WriteLine("0没有倒数。");
}
}
}
```
在上述代码中,我们首先检查`originalNumber`是否为零,以避免除以零的错误。
阅读全文